Didi Gregorius could land on disabled list with heel injury

Didi Gregorius

The New York Yankees could be without shortstop Didi Gregorius for a bit after he injured his foot during Sunday’s game against the Toronto Blue Jays.

Gregorius bruised his left heel in the first inning when he collided with Toronto’s Kendrys Morales while running out an infield single. Gregorius stayed in the game for two innings before ultimately departing.

Manager Aaron Boone characterized the injury as “significant” and admitted it could land Gregorius on the disabled list.

Gregorius would be a tough loss for the Yankees. He had been hitting .270 with 22 home runs.

Between this and Aaron Judge, the Yankees are dealing with some major position player headaches right now. They’re unlikely to win the AL East no matter what, though, so as long as they consolidate the first wild card spot, they’ll be doing as well as they could be.
